Financial Investment and Payment Options

Affordable Tuition Structure

Pulse Radiology Institute provides transparent and competitive tuition for Hornsby Bend, TX students, with complete education investment of $23,250 that covers all instructional components and materials needed for successful program completion. Our structured payment schedule commences with a accessible minimal $100 registration fee and a reasonable $5,000 down payment, maintained by manageable monthly payments of only $900 for 20 months. This payment structure enables Hornsby Bend, TX students to graduate free from student debt, avoiding the economic stress that typically results from conventional academic degrees. The final fee of only $150 is due before degree conferral, concluding the full tuition obligation.

If you’re considering a career in MRI or diagnostic imaging, it’s important to understand the radiologic technologist requirements you’ll need to meet before practicing. These standards are set by the American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T), which oversees certification and ensures that technologists meet consistent levels of education, training, and ethical practice. While the process may seem complicated at first, breaking it down into clear steps makes it easier to navigate.

What Are the Radiologic Technologist Requirements?

Step 1: Meet the Basic Educational Prerequisites – Your journey starts with general education. To qualify for certification, you’ll need at least a high school diploma or GED. After that, the ARRT requires an associate’s degree or higher in any field from an institution they recognize. Many people choose to pursue degrees directly tied to healthcare or imaging, but technically, your associate’s degree doesn’t have to be in radiology—as long as you meet the rest of the requirements through an accredited program.

Step 2: Complete an Accredited Radiologic Program – The next step is enrolling in a program that specifically trains you in radiologic technology or MRI. Accredited programs cover both the classroom theory and the hands-on skills you’ll need. Coursework usually includes:

  • Anatomy and physiology

  • MRI physics and image production

  • Patient care and communication

  • Safety and ethics in medical imaging

In addition to classes, programs also arrange clinical training, where you’ll practice under supervision in hospitals, imaging centers, or clinics. Depending on your program, this may mean 1,000 to 2,000 documented clinical hours before you graduate. These hours are not just a requirement—they’re also your chance to build confidence and learn how to apply classroom concepts to real patients.

Step 3: Prepare for the ARRT Certification Exam – Once you’ve completed your education and clinical requirements, you’ll need to sit for the ARRT certification exam. This is a 200-question test that evaluates your knowledge across four main areas:

  • Image production

  • Procedures and protocols

  • Patient care

  • Safety practices

The exam is designed to test both what you know in theory and how well you can apply it in practice. Many programs, including Pulse Radiology Institute, build exam preparation into their curriculum with weekly tests, review modules, and even mock exams. This way, you can approach the certification with confidence instead of anxiety.

Step 4: Understand Ongoing Requirements – Certification isn’t a one-and-done step. To maintain your ARRT credential, you’ll need to renew it every two years. Renewal requires earning 24 continuing education (CE) credits, which can include workshops, online courses, or advanced academic study at ARRT-accredited institutions. You’ll also need to maintain your CPR certification.

These requirements aren’t just red tape—they’re designed to ensure technologists stay current in a field that evolves quickly with new technologies, procedures, and safety protocols.
